Embodiment Construction

[0026] In order to make the object, technical solution and advantages of the present invention clearer, the present invention will be further described in detail below in conjunction with the accompanying drawings. It should be understood that the specific embodiments described here are only used to explain the present invention, not to limit the present invention.

[0027] According to an embodiment of the present invention, a smart TV human-computer interaction device is provided. Such as figure 1 As shown, the device includes:

[0028] The remote control module 101 is adapted to receive user operations and generate corresponding control signals, including:

[0029] (1) The user presses a certain function key of the remote control module to generate a control signal for dividing the current screen;

Abstract

The invention provides a smart television human-computer interaction device based on a remote controller. The device comprises a remote controller module, a server module, an region-of-interest generation module, an region-of-interest initially determining module and an output module, wherein the remote controller module is suitable for receiving user operation and producing a corresponding control signal; the server module is suitable for receiving and analyzing the control signal to obtain a command; the region-of interest generation module is suitable for obtaining a current television picture according to the command of dividing the current picture, and cutting the current television picture to obtain a potential region and feeding back the potential region to the server module; the region-of-interest initially determining module is suitable for selecting the region-of-interest according to the command of a selected region, and feeding back the selected region-of-interest to the server module; the output module is suitable for receiving and outputting a potential regional image and a selected region-of-interest image. The invention further provides a system comprising the device, and a method based on the device. The smart television human-computer interaction method, device and system based on the remote controller, provided by the invention can be used for enabling a user to utilize the remote controller to conveniently click and select a target-of-interest in the television picture.

Description

technical field [0001] The invention relates to the field of smart TVs, in particular to a remote control-based smart TV human-computer interaction method, device and system. Background technique [0002] With the development of society, TV will gradually develop into an open service carrying platform and become a home intelligent entertainment terminal. Smart TV will have application platform advantages that traditional TV manufacturers do not have. Smart TV will realize various application services such as network search, IP TV, video on demand (VOD), digital music, network news, and network video calling.
